mag reinfore onweps and items what exactly does this do?

Mag. Atk = [Mag. attack power + (Int stat * Mag. Reinforce)]
It directly affects your damage output.

Reinforcement on weapon are very important and they add more damage when highest is your level and if you are pure or hybrid. Taking account that is a damage that depend on the amount of int or str, higher mag reinf has more effect on a pure int than on a hybrid int. To give you numbers:
Highest mag attack of a lvl72 spear it varies from 1287-1373 and the mag reinforments varies from 275 to 286. If the one that wield the spear is a pure int lvl80 with 50 int on his gear he will have 386int points, so if we use the reinforements values of that spear we get extra damage from reinforcement that varies from 1061-1104. Looking at this numbers having 100% on mag attack provide 86 extra damage and having 100% on reinforcement provide 43 extra damage (exactly the half, I dont know if it coincidence), so you do get more damage having higher % on attack than on reinf, but the reinf values should not be ignore (take into account that each + that has the spear add 40 damage, so a good % on reinf is like having an extra + on the weapon  ).

false Quote: str is about physical aspect. The higher, the better your crits, physical resistance, physical damge, life span.
int is about magical aspect. The higher, the better your magic attack, magical resistance, and mana span.
false and all are false....... Phy/Mag have nothing to do with durability, but with your stat base. It's the bonus of damage added when u equip your weapon. Here is an exemple :   The mag power of my blade 56+3 is 705. With a mag reinforce 166.3%, and with 207 Int comes from my build, the bonus mag power when equip the weapon is 207*166.3%=344.2. So my final power when equip the weapon is 705+344.2=1049.2. mag power (when weapon equiped) = mag power (weapon) + [mag reinforce (weapon) * Int] Same with phy reinforce but apply with str. Whoever Said This wrote: Same with phy reinforce but apply with str.
It's different for physical attack power.
Phy. Atk = [Phy. attack power + (Str stat * Phy. Reinforce)] * [1 + weapon mastery/100]
